Your water level must be at least 4"-8" below the tile line. If you do not lower your water, we will lower it for you for an additional fee. Pools under 40,000 gallons (this is most pools) will be charged $75 for this service. Pools larger than 40,000 gallons will be charged $125.

Yes, but please do not throw your safety cover away. Getting a new cover is approximately a 6-week process. We recommend starting the process in June or July. We will provide you with an estimate within $300 of it's actual cost. If you approve the estimate, we will come pick up your cover and send it to the manufacturer for a remake. This way it will fit exactly like your old one on the same anchors already in place.

If you do not check on your pool after it's closed, we highly recommend it. Our winter service plans include lowering the water when needed, making sure your skimmers remain winterized and full of antifreeze, and keeping debris off your cover. Winter service plans are similar to an insurance policy; we protect your investment when it's most at risk.
